summaryrefslogtreecommitdiff
path: root/src/polaris
AgeCommit message (Collapse)Author
2022-12-25polaris -> syncleoEvgeny Zinoviev
2022-07-02polaris/protocol: change log level when logging about dropped duplicated packetEvgeny Zinoviev
2022-07-02polaris/protocol: fix debug log when dropping duplicated incoming packetEvgeny Zinoviev
2022-07-02polaris/protocol: delete PingMessage from queue immediately, just like ACK/NAKsEvgeny Zinoviev
2022-07-02polaris/protocol: ping improvementsEvgeny Zinoviev
2022-07-02polaris/protocol: improve debug logsEvgeny Zinoviev
2022-07-02polaris/protocol: change log level of some annoying messageEvgeny Zinoviev
2022-07-02polaris_kettle_bot: make READ_TIMEOUT configurableEvgeny Zinoviev
2022-07-02polaris/protocol: handle encryption errors, don't let them crash the appEvgeny Zinoviev
2022-07-01polaris: change some log message levelsEvgeny Zinoviev
2022-07-01polaris/protocol: don't increment Message ids forever, got back to 0 after ↵Evgeny Zinoviev
100000
2022-07-01polaris/protocol: change some log levelsEvgeny Zinoviev
2022-07-01polaris/protocol: resend PingMessages if no responseEvgeny Zinoviev
2022-07-01polaris_kettle_bot: add /temp command and moreEvgeny Zinoviev
2022-06-30polaris pwk 1725cgld full supportEvgeny Zinoviev
- significant improvements, correctnesses and stability fixes in protocol implementation - correct handling of device appearances and disappearances - flawlessly functioning telegram bot that re-renders kettle's state (temperature and other) in real time
2022-06-27polaris kettle workEvgeny Zinoviev
- polaris iot protocol implementation rewrite - fix temperature setting - fix power mode setting - sometimes responses don't come back, i think it's due to fragile nature of UDP. Need to implement message resending until response is received.
2022-06-26somewhat working kettle communicationEvgeny Zinoviev
- handshake works - it powers on and off - temperature control is still WIP